What happened
Landlord applied for an order to terminate the tenancy and evict Tenants due to failure to pay rent. The application was filed after serving a valid Notice to End Tenancy Early for Non-payment of Rent (N4 Notice), which the tenants did not void by paying the arrears. The tenants were still in possession of the rental unit at the time of the hearing.
The ruling
The tenancy will be terminated on April 24, 2023 unless the tenants pay $4,804.56 to the landlord or the LTB in trust by that date to void the order. If the tenants do not pay the required amount, they must vacate the unit by April 24, 2023. The landlord is entitled to daily compensation of $63.33 for each day of occupation starting February 17, 2023 until the tenants vacate.
